What Is a Gale? Wind Speeds, Effects, and Classification Differentiating Gales from Other Wind Events A gale is specifically defined by its sustained intensity, which distinguishes it from both weaker and stronger wind phenomena A “storm” on the Beaufort scale is the next step up from a gale, typically classified as Force 10 or 11, with wind speeds starting at 48 knots
What are Gales? Understanding Their Causes and Effects Gales are defined by the U S National Weather Service as sustained surface winds between 34 and 47 knots, which is about 39 to 54 miles per hour These powerful winds are often associated with large-scale weather systems such as low-pressure areas, cyclones, or tropical storms
